What is the most beautiful tree in Indiana?

As a gardening and landscaping expert, I have had the pleasure of witnessing the beauty of numerous trees in Indiana. However, one tree that stands out to me as particularly stunning is the American plum tree (Prunus americana). Its appearance during full bloom is truly a sight to behold.

When the American plum tree is in full bloom, it is a sight that captivates the senses. The tree is adorned with delicate white blossoms that cover its branches, creating a picturesque scene. The contrast between the vibrant green leaves and the pure white flowers creates a visually striking display. It is a tree that demands attention and admiration.

What sets the American plum tree apart from other trees is its ability to attract a myriad of pollinators. During its blooming period, bees, butterflies, and other insects flock to the tree, drawn by the sweet fragrance and abundance of nectar. This not only adds to the visual appeal of the tree but also contributes to the overall health of the surrounding ecosystem.

Another aspect of the American plum tree’s beauty lies in its versatility. It can thrive in a variety of environments, from urban landscapes to rural gardens. Its adaptability makes it a popular choice for homeowners and landscapers alike. Whether planted as a standalone specimen or in a group, the American plum tree never fails to make a statement.

In addition to its aesthetic appeal, the American plum tree also offers practical benefits. It produces delicious and nutritious plums that can be enjoyed fresh or used in a variety of culinary creations. These plums are not only a treat for humans but also provide a valuable food source for wildlife such as birds and small mammals.
